Business
TVA Group Inc. operates as one of Canada's leading communications companies, focusing on French-language broadcasting, film production and audiovisual services, magazines, and production and distribution, primarily serving Quebec and French-speaking audiences across Canada. Founded in 1960 and headquartered at 612 Saint-Jacques Street in Montreal, Quebec, the company functions as a subsidiary of Quebecor Media Inc. and manages North America's largest private French-language television network through six owned stations, including flagship CFTM-TV (Montreal) and regional stations in Quebec City, Sherbrooke, Trois-Rivières, Rimouski-Matane-Sept-Îles, and Saguenay/Lac St-Jean, plus four affiliated stations; nine specialty channels such as ADDIK, CASA, Évasion, LCN, Prise 2, QUB (formerly YOOPA), TVA Sports (with multiplexes TVA Sports 2 and 3), TÉMOIN (formerly MOI ET CIE), and Zeste; digital platforms including the TVA+ app, qub.ca, and TVA Sports app with on-demand and streaming content; commercial production via Qolab; soundstage, mobile, and production equipment rentals through MELS (18 stages totaling 212,000 square feet), postproduction including digital intermediate, audio mixing, visual effects, and virtual production, plus media accessibility services like dubbing and described video; magazine publishing via TVA Publications covering arts, entertainment, television, fashion, and decor with digital extensions and the Molto app; and production and distribution of television shows, movies, and series via Incendo group (featuring romantic comedies, horror films, and drama series) and TVA Films for global markets including video-on-demand, pay-TV, and theatrical distribution as Quebec distributor for Paramount Pictures. Recent major changes include the January 2024 rebranding of YOOPA to QUB (public affairs) and MOI ET CIE to TÉMOIN, alongside the December 2023 launch of the TVA Sports app and Direct streaming platform; ongoing restructuring from a 2022 reorganization plan entailing cessation of in-house entertainment production, news division optimization, and real estate adjustments, followed by elimination of 140 positions in February 2023 and 87 primarily unionized roles in its Broadcasting segment in November 2025 to pursue profitability amid competitive pressures; goodwill impairment and net losses reported in Q2 2025; and May 2025 election of directors including new appointee Régine Laurent.
